Last night I was thinking about WLS things in general and the subject of just how much we change kept coming to the forefront. We talk about the scales everyday and when we hit a stall we look to the measurements to see change. Have you checked your BMI lately?
When I started looking into surgery I weighed it at 305. For my 5'5" frame that's a BMI of 50.7 and that's in the Super Morbidly obese category. This morning my BMI is now 34.9 and just plain Obese. When I lose 30 more lbs. I'll be just Overweight. (Plus I'll weigh what I did in Elementary school). How cool is that?
